This 6-inch Audiopipe subwoofer balances small size and serious output for cars, motorcycles, and compact enclosures where space is limited but bass performance still matters. With a 4-ohm impedance, a 1.5" 4-layer voice coil, and a strontium 25 oz magnet, the TS-CAR6 is engineered to deliver crisp low frequencies down to 60 Hz while tolerating everyday driving conditions and moderate power levels.
How loud and powerful is the TS-CAR6 for a small subwoofer?
The TS-CAR6 handles up to 150 watts peak (PMPO) and 75 watts RMS, giving it enough headroom for punchy bass in small vehicles or sealed boxes. Its 85 dB sensitivity helps it respond well to modest amplifiers without needing excessive power to be heard.
- Peak power: 150 watts (PMPO)
- Continuous power: 75 watts RMS
- Sensitivity: 85 dB for efficient output
- Optimal with compact amplifiers suited to 4-ohm loads
What frequency range and sound character can I expect?
The driver covers roughly 60–3000 Hz, so it focuses on low-end presence and upper-bass articulation rather than deep subsonic extension that larger woofers provide. Expect tight, punchy bass that improves impact and definition for rock, electronic, and urban music in smaller cabins.
- Frequency response: 60–3000 Hz for defined bass and low-mid clarity
- Strontium magnet and 1.5" 4-layer voice coil aid transient response
- Best suited for sealed or small ported enclosures to keep bass tight
- Not intended for very deep sub-bass below 50 Hz
Will it fit in my vehicle and how do I mount it?
The TS-CAR6 has a shallow mounting depth of 177 mm (3.03") and compact overall dimensions, making it practical for cramped spaces such as trunk lids, door pods, or custom dash locations. Verify your enclosure depth and cutout diameter before installation to ensure a secure, vibration-free fit.
- Driver size: 6-inch cone for tight fitment
- Mounting depth: 177 mm (3.03") for shallow installations
- Impedance: 4 ohms — match to amp channel capability
- Physical package: approx. 8" x 8" x 4.8", 5 pounds
What are the reliability and build details I should know?
Audiopipe designs the TS-CAR6 with a robust 1.5" 4-layer voice coil and a 25 oz strontium magnet to handle sustained use and preserve sound quality under typical onboard conditions. The driver’s construction emphasizes durability and consistent performance for enthusiasts and everyday users alike.
- Voice coil: 1.5" with four layers for thermal handling
- Magnet: 25 oz strontium for stable magnetic flux
- Rated impedance: 4 ohm nominal for broad amp compatibility
- Weight: about 5 pounds for a solid, well-built driver
Who is this for? The Audiopipe TS-CAR6 is aimed at audio enthusiasts and DIY installers who need a compact subwoofer that delivers authoritative mid-bass without sacrificing cabin space. It’s ideal for tight enclosures, custom pods, motorcycles, and vehicles where a full-size subwoofer won’t fit but improved bass impact is desired. Pair it with a small dedicated amplifier or a conservative channel on a multi-channel amp to get optimal results without risking driver overload.
FAQ
Q: Is the TS-CAR6 compatible with a 4-channel amp?
A: Yes. The TS-CAR6 is 4 ohms; use a channel rated for 4 ohms or bridge channels per the amp’s manual for proper power matching.
Q: Can I use this driver in a sealed enclosure?
A: Absolutely. The TS-CAR6 performs well in sealed or small ported boxes, favoring tight, punchy bass response over deep extension.
